INSIGHT

Moral vs Political Dilemma

  • You can either be moral or political, but not both, because politics requires seeing the other side as an enemy.
  • Moral hypocrisy becomes the winning strategy in politics as conceding points means losing the struggle.
INSIGHT

Religion as Political Alternative

  • The alternative to being political in today's sense is to be religious, placing hope in another world beyond temporal things.
  • Being religious frees you from political games and teaches navigating reality with humility and caution.
INSIGHT

Spirituality and Politics

  • A spirituality-based left might replace materialism with linking to a higher reality, as seen in Mark Fisher's longing.
  • Current politics often devolve to religion masquerading as politics, leading to tragic consequences.
